Chapter 7

First Kiss


Their first kiss happened by accident. If anyone were to ask when their first kiss was, they would both say, "On New Years Eve when we were both adults." That would be a lie.

In reality, it happened when Arthur was 17 and Ludwig was 15. Gilbert was hosting a party at his house while his father was away on business for the weekend and so Arthur had been called in to help set things up. Ludwig had been unwillingly recruited to help as well.

"Lud, did you get the chip and dip out?" Gilbert called from the upstairs.

"Yes," the younger teenager replied irritably.

"And Artie, you set up the big screen, right?"

Arthur said a few choice swear words before replying. "Yes, for the one hundredth time, Gilbert!"

Gilbert almost flew down the stairs. "Man, this is gonna be the most badass party ever."

"If you say so," Arthur grumbled.

It wasn't long before people started arriving. Ludwig was forced to serve drinks and Arthur was told to look out for him so the two of them went to the kitchen, both angry at Gilbert for making them work so hard.

"This party is stupid," Arthur sighed.

Ludwig cocked his head to the side. "You think so too?"

"I don't even knowhalf these people."

"Maybe Father will come home early from his business trip…"

"We can only hope, right?" Arthur chuckled a little.

Gilbert walked into the kitchen, glaring at them. "Yo, guys, people want drinks out there."

"Right, right," Arthur rolled his eyes.

Ludwig glared at his brother and finished pouring the drinks. "You should treat me nicer if you don't want me telling Father, Gilbert."

"…Are you threateningme, Lud?" Gilbert towered over him.

"Hey, hey, leave him alone," Arthur said, blocking Ludwig from Gilbert's intense glare. "Go be a good host or whatever. We'll bring the drinks out soon."

"You better." Gilbert walked back out to mingle among his guests, leaving a very tense atmosphere behind.

"I swear, his ego makes him such an arse sometimes," Arthur snarled.

"You didn't have to defend me, Arthur."

Arthur shrugged. "I'm a little brother myself. I know what it's like to be treated like shite."

"Well…thanks."

"No problem. Careful with those drinks there."

Ludwig was almost back into the room with the party when someone rushed by and knocked him off balance. He fell back into Arthur and they both fell to the floor. All the drinks spilled around them. But that wasn't Ludwig's main concern right now. He turned around to see if Arthur was all right.

"Arthur?" He shook the older boy.

Green eyes opened slowly. Arthur sat up quickly and didn't seem to realize just how close Ludwig was. Their lips met instantly. Ludwig's eyes were wide and Arthur's were even wider. Arthur pulled back quickly, hiding his blush and standing up on wobbly legs. "L-Let's pretend nothing happened," he mumbled.

Ludwig nodded, his own cheeks just as red. He never imagined years later they'd be kissing again.
